Engage students on day one of school with one of the most important lessons all year- "why do we study chemistry?" In this lesson, students go around the room to 6 different stations and record reasons to study chemistry, discuss what each means and why its important. After completing each station, they rank them in order of importance (either with their group or individually) and then debate as a class. Then, they complete a shirt, structured writing arguing the best reason to study chemistry.
